Hotaru DestinyDecade If I were to omit all those 2 montha of the dead silence from the support's department that deals with hacked account, I ended up making a new ticket that wasn't mentioning anything about my account getting stolen.
I pretty much had to come up with a story that I need to remove 2FA as I changed a phone number. It was because hacker made an separate accoung using my email. And so, support could only offer deleting it as I didn't have any back up codes. I had to wait for 2 weeks.
And then, a day before the "deadline" I explained the situation to the same real person who was helping with deleting the account. Once tgey got that email, they did both at once. Deleted a fake account and reverted the email for the original one.
I hope that explains my entire process. It is awful that I had to talk my way out from this mess by coming up with a story to at least somehow push things through
